Power to Survive Cancer Recovery Program

Power to Survive is a fitness program available at The Clark Sports Center in Cooperstown, Y Specialty Fitness in Oneonta,  The Cardio Club & Delhi Dance Studio in Delhi, NY, and Live Well Fitness Little Falls and Live Well Fitness Health & Wellness Center in St. Johnsville, NY designed to help cancer survivors regain their strength after completing their cancer treatment. These programs focus on helping survivors regain their strength and overall wellness. All cancer survivors who live in our community are welcome to participate, regardless of when or where their treatment was completed.

Cancer Survivor Program Potential Outline

Generally, the Power to Survive fitness program spans eight weeks, with two 45-minute classes per week. Please speak with each individual fitness program to learn more about how their program is set-up.
